| 27 //! \brief Implements the state and state transitions of a single named pipe for | |
| 28 //! the Crashpad client registration protocol for Windows. Each pipe | |
| 29 //! instance may handle a single client connection at a time. After each | |
| 30 //! connection completes, whether successfully or otherwise, the instance | |
| 31 //! will attempt to return to a listening state, ready for a new client | |
| 32 //! connection. | |
| 33 class RegistrationPipeState { | |
| 34 public: | |
| 35 //! \brief Initializes the state for a single pipe instance. The client must | |
| 36 //! call Initialize() before clients may connect to this pipe. | |
| 37 //! \param[in] pipe The named pipe to listen on. | |
| 38 //! \param[in] delegate The delegate that will be used to handle requests. | |
| 39 RegistrationPipeState(ScopedFileHANDLE pipe, | |
| 40 RegistrationServer::Delegate* delegate); | |
| 41 ~RegistrationPipeState(); | |
| 42 | |
| 43 //! \brief Places the pipe in the running state, ready to receive and process | |
| 44 //! client connections. Before destroying a running RegistrationPipeState | |
| 45 //! instance you must invoke Stop() and then wait for completion_event() | |
| 46 //! to be signaled one last time. | |
| 47 //! \return Returns true if successful, in which case the client must observe | |
| 48 //! completion_event() and invoke OnCompletion() whenever it is signaled. | |
| 49 bool Initialize(); | |
| 50 | |
| 51 //! \brief Cancels any pending asynchronous operations. After invoking this | |
| 52 //! method you must wait for completion_event() to be signaled before | |
| 53 //! destroying the instance. | |
| 54 void Stop(); | |
| 55 | |
| 56 //! \brief Returns an event handle that will be signaled whenever an | |
| 57 //! asynchronous operation associated with this instance completes. | |
| 58 HANDLE completion_event() { return event_.get(); } | |
| 59 | |
| 60 //! \brief Must be called by the client whenever completion_event() is | |
| 61 //! signaled. | |
